Kristen's 482whp 35R Stock cam IX
Kristen is a NW original with a very clean TB Evo IX. The car has seen some battle damage but in the course of time it led to some upgrades that prepared the car for where it is now.
Mods prior-
ETS 3" FMIC with piping
ER SD and intake
Omnipower 4 bar MAP sensor
Cobb DP
ETS 3" exhaust
Stock Cams
This made for a best of 360whp-
TJ, our fab guy and resident DaVinci, bought a 35R kit for the car that needed some revamp but had made 420whp on the former owner's car. We arent quite sure what kit it is but it looks like an old RNR kit. One thing that needed attention was the O2 housing, it was shaped like this and had a recirc'd WG -
<
A normal O2 housing and external dump were engineered and then the whole thing was installed.
Next mods-
RNR 3582 (standard) with 0.63 5 bolt Ford turbine housing
Custom ER O2 housing
FIC 850s
On straight 92 and the stock cams it tapped out at 439whp on the edge of knock-
Since we are always testing new concepts (and old ones we haven't dyno'd) TJ wanted to mix in some E100 and make the car run on E25. As you can see I intentionally left the straight 92 octane tune rich. With zero changes to the tune other than mixing some E25 we bumped it up-
The 1.5 gallons we added to the 6 gallons in the tank leaned it out 0.5 points and killed any knock we were seeing. A pull or 2 later the fuel had mixed better and this ended up at an 11.78 (from 10.97) which is still obviously safe. We decided to exploit the octane and went higher with the boost, never encountering knock-
All in all, the little bit of ethanol we mixed in allowed us to turn up the boost, make another 40whp+ without knock, and still run slightly better than pump timing. Alcohol is one helluva a drug

I Remember when E85 first came out doing something similar on my DD EVO8 I would fill up with 8 Gallons of 93 And 2 Gallons of E85, With my normal 93 tune.
Just like you stated It Provided a noticeable increase in power while killing any knock (even 1-2s) that were present.

Great post Aaron! This gives me some ideas... From your tests I think I could also make an E25 mixture and just lower injector size by about 7% to keep the same AFR´s as with 93 oct, then maybe just lean it a little via fuel map.
We have E97 sort of available here in Peru, so before going straight to a blend of E85, and probably running out of fuel pump/system, I could give E25 - E30 a try. This seems to be a better alternative to meth injection.
